Until one is committed.
there is hesitancy,
the chance to draw back,
always ineffectiveness.
Concerning all acts of initiative and creation
there is one elementary truth,
the ignorance of which kills countless ideas
and splendid plans:
that the moment one definitely commits oneself,
then Providence moves too.
All Sorts of things occur
to help one that would never otherwise have occurred.
A whole stream of events issues from the decision,
raising in one's favour all manner
of unforeseen incidents and meetings
and material assistance,
which no man could have dreamed
would have some his way.
I have learned a deep respect for one of Goethe's couplets:
Whatever you can do
or dream you can, begin it.
Boldness has genius, power and magic in it.
W.H. Murray
The Scottish Himalayan Expedition
